Uhhh....I think Ross was being 'clever' there. You almost certainly do need a heater in your tank. If your water temperature ever goes below 78 or 79 degrees F, then you want a heater.

If your water temp ever goes above 81-82 then you need a way to cool it (chiller, fans or move the tank to a cooler spot in the house).
